SubjectRe: [OT] how to catch HW fault
On Sat, Mar 17, 2001 at 01:22:46PM -0500, you [Aaron Lunansky] claimed:
> Sounds like the only thing you haven't swapped out of your machine is the
> ram/cpu.
>
> It could very well be your ram (I don't suspect the cpu). If you can, try a
> different stick of ram.

Or try memtest86 (http://reality.sgi.com/cbrady_denver/memtest86/) it's a
very good memory tester. My first option if I suspect a hardware fault.
